Complex training is an exercise method that combines plyometrics with strength training. This exercise is an exercise used to increase muscle power. This study aims to determine the effect of training of complex training methods towards leg muscle power and arm muscle power for adolescent volleyball athletes. The method used in this study is an experiment with a control group pretest - post test design. Subjects in this study are 23 adolescent volleyball athletes (14-17 years old) with 12 males and 11 females, who are divided into two groups of experimental groups (n = 12) and control groups (n = 11) with randomized matched pair design based on the ranking of the vertical jump ability. Instrument used in this study is vertical jump test (leg power) and the medicine ball throw test (arm power). The data analysis technique uses the paired t-test with a significance level of α = 0.05. The results show that training using a complex training method provides a good benefit in improving leg and arm muscle power. Therefore, this method is appropriate for used by adolescent volleyball athletes that have had experience of weight training in improving muscle power towards adolescent volleyball athletes

Selisih posstest sebesar 1,75 cm. EFFECT OF PLYOMETRIC BOX JUMP AND PLYOMETRIC STANDING JUMP TOWARD VERTICAL JUMP ABILITY IN VOLLEY BALL CLUB ATHLETES AbstractThis study aims to determine: 1) is there any influence of Box jump training on vertical jumps of Ganevo male athletes aged 14-17 years, 2) is there any influence of standing jump exercises on vertical jumps of Ganevo male athletes aged 14-17 years, 3) is there any types of exercises give effective effect toward vertical jump of male athlete Ganevo aged 14-17 years. This research is an experiment study using two groups pretest-posttest design. The instrument in this study was a vertical jump test with a reliability of 0.99 and a validity of 0.989. Subjects in this study were Ganevo Volleyball Club Athletes Aged 14-17 Years, 24 Athletes in total as subjects. Data analysis techniques used the t test with a significance level of 5%.The results of the study concluded: (1) there was an effect of plyometric box jump training on the vertical jump of male volleyball athlete Ganevo Age 14-17 years, with t count (8,660)> t table (2,201), and the Significance value (0,000) < of (0 , 05), (2) there is the influence of plyometric standing jump training on the vertical jump of male volleyball athlete Ganevo Age 14-17 years, with t arithmetic (3,522) > t table (2,201), and the Significance value (0.005) < of (0 , 05), (3) plyometric standing jump training is better to increase vertical jump for volleyball athletes of Ganevo men aged 14-17 years, with t arithmetic (2,133)> t table (1,720), and significance value (0.026) <of ( 0.05). Post-test difference of 1.75 cm.

Muscle power was defined as the combination between speed and strenght of muscle contraction and enters in the fitness components. Plyometrics exercises can be used to improve the skills of volleyball players. This study was an experimental study using research designs pre test and post test control group design. The sampling technique inthis study with a simple random sampling. The total sample of 20 person so in one group consisted of 10 person. The first group was given additional ballistic stretching on knee tuck jump exercise. The second group was given knee tuck jump exercise. Measurements of leg muscle power using vertical jump test. Normality test p > 0.05 and homogeneitytest p > 0.05. The results showed an increase in leg muscle power in first group amounted to 14.30 cm and in second group an increase of 7.70 cm. Paired samples t-test p value = 0.000 (p <0.05) in first group and p = 0.000 (p < 0.05) in second group. Test increase explosive power leg muscle after exercise in both groups using independent sample t-test obtained first group and second group where p = 0.000 (p <0.05) with an increase in the percentage of 30.95% in the first group and 16.73% in the second group. From the research done can be concluded that the addition of ballisticstretching on knee tuck jump exercise is more effective than knee tuck jump exercise in increasing explosive power leg muscle in male volleyball players Medical Faculty Of Udayana University. Kata Kunci : alternate leg bound, pelatihan knee tuck jump, daya ledak otot tungkai This research is aimed to knowing the effect of alternate leg bound training and knee tuck jump to the enhancement the explosive power leg muscles. This type of research is use quasi-experiment with “the non-randomized control group pretest posttest design. The subject of this research is student participant of volley ball extracurricular SMP Negeri 2 Singaraja as much 36 people, and then divided into 3 groups with ordinal pairing technique that is 12 people given alternate leg bound, 12 people given knee tuck jump training, and 12 people control groups. Explosive power is measured by vertical jump test. Data was analyzed by F test ( one way anova) with significance level (α)= 0,05, through SPSS 16.0. Analysis result indicate a change in the average value of the variable explosive power. In alternate lef bound groups there is increased, in knee tuck jump groups increase and contril goups there is not increased explosive power. The result of one way anova test, explosive power variables between the treatment groups and control group gained f count 58,920 and significance 0.000 that mean contained different effect between alternate leg bound training and knee tuck jump. Based of the result LSD test, knee tuck jump groups training have a better effect than alternate leg bound to the enhancement explosive power leg muscles.keyword : alternate leg bound training, knee tuck jump training, explosive leg muscles

Disarankan bagi guru olahraga, pelatih, pembina serta atlet untuk menggunakan pelatihan medicine ball sit-up throw sebagai salah satu alternatif dalam meningkatkan kekuatan otot lengan dan kekuatan otot punggung.Kata Kunci : medicine ball sit-up throw, kekuatan otot lengan, kekuatan otot punggung This study aims to determine the effect of medicine ball sit-up throw training to arm muscle power and back muscle power. The research is quasi-experimentally in which the randomized pre-test post-test control group design. Sample were male students SMP N 4 Singaraja numbered 44 people. The instrument used for research testing arm muscle power is push-up 60 second while the instrument to test the back muscle power is back and leg dynamometer. Furthermore the data were analyzed by independent t-test at a significance level of less (α) of 0,05 with SPSS 16.0. Based on the results of independent t-test showed; (1) variable arm muscle power with significance value 0,000, (2) variable back muscle power with significance value 0,010. The significance value calculated is less than the value of α (0,05), so the hypothesis research ”medicine ball sit-up throw effect on arm muscle power and back muscle power” accepted. It can be concluded that the training medicine ball sit-up throw significant effect on the increase in arm muscle power and back muscle power on male students SMP N 4 Singaraja in the academic year of 2015/2016. For sports teachers, trainers, coaches and athletes are advised to use alternate training as medicine ball sit-up throw alternative way to increase arm muscle power and back muscle power.keyword : medicine ball sit-up throw, arm muscle power, back muscle power.

This study aims to determine the effect of 50 meter sprint exercise on soil media and sprint 50 meters on sand media against explosive muscle limb power. This type of research is an experiment with the design of non randomized control group pretest posttest design. The subjects of the study were students of class VIII SMP N 3 Banjar 2016/2017 academic year amounted to 32 people, Then divided into 2 groups using ordinal pairing technique, which is 16 people given sprint training 50 meters on the soil media and 16 people were given training sprint 50 meters on the sand media. Limb muscle explosive power is measured by a vertical jump test. The data can be analyzed by the Independent t-test at the level of significance (α) = 0.05 with the help program of SPSS 16.0. The results of data analysis showed a change in mean values on explosive muscle power variables. In the sprint treatment group 50 meters on the soil media an increase of 9,75, in the sprint treatment group 50 meters on the sand media increased by 15,88. The result of t-test of Independent variable of explosive muscle limb between sprint treatment group 50 meter on soil media and sprint 50 meter on sand media obtained tcount value 2,789 and significance 0,009 which means there is a difference of effect between 50 meter sprint exercise on soil media and sprint 50 meter on sand media to explosive power of leg muscle. Based on the result of data analysis Post-test average value of treatment group, The 50 meter sprint training group on the sand media is better than the 50 meter sprint training on the soil media against an increase in explosive muscle power of the legs of 15,88. From the results of data analysis in the discussion concluded that : (1) 50 meter sprint training on soil media and 50 meter sprint on sand media affect the increase of explosive power of leg muscle. (2) there is a difference of influence between 50 meter sprint training on soil media and sprint 50 meter on sand media to increase power of explosion of leg muscle. (3) 50 meter sprint training on sand media is better than 50 meter sprint on soil media to increase explosive power of leg muscle. keyword : 50 meter sprint training on soil media, 50 meter sprint training on sand media, explosive muscle power of the legs.

Abstract This study aims to determine the effect of leap quick and double leg speed hop research to increase leg muscle power. The design of this study is the non-randomized control group pretest post-test design. The subjects were female students who join volleyball extracurricular SMP Negeri 3 Mendoyo amounted to 45 students. Data were analyzed by F (one way anova) test at significance level (a) = 0.05 with the help of SPSS 16.0. The results of data analysis in the quick leap treatment group, an increase on lamb muscle power of 27.4, in the treatment group double leg speed hop of 11.6 and in the control group of 0.33. One way anova variable of limb muscle power variable between treatment group and control group was obtained Fcount 22.225 and significance 0.000, which means difference of influence between quick leap and double leg speed hop training toward leg muscle power. It was concluded that; (1) the influence between quick leap and double leg speed hop training significantly influenced the increase of leg muscle power, (2) there is significant difference of influence between quick leap and double leg speed hop training toward increasing leg muscle power, (3) quick leap training more Both on double leg speed hop against increased leg muscle power. Suggestion: (1) for trainers it is advisable to use this training in improving leg muscle power, (2) for athletes need to care for cells and proper repetition because each individual has different capabilities, (3) for researchers who want to do similar research is suggested using variables and Different research samples. keyword : Key Words: quick leap, double leg speed hop, explosive muscle limb power.

Background: Tuberculosis (TB) is a global health problem, Indonesia had the second rank of the case in the world after India which is the fourth cause of death. Giving vitamin D together with anti-tuberculosis drugs can increase healing proses because vitamin D (anti-microbial immunomodulators) kills Mycobacterium tuberculosis.Objectives: This study aims to measure the effect of giving anti-tuberculosis drugs with vitamin D on changes in AFB in patients with pulmonary tuberculosis.Methods: This study was used a quasi-experiment design, pre-test and post-test control group was doing at 25th March – 25th July 2019. This research has been conducted in Pidie Regency. The intervention group (17 samples with tuberculosis drugs) was given Softgels vitamin D 5000 IU for 4 months, while the control group was only anti-tuberculosis drug therapy. The data were analyzed statistically using the Wilcoxon and Mann Whitney tests at a significance level of 95%.Results: Before the intervention, the BTA status of both the intervention and control group was similar (p= 0.061). After the intervention, there was a decrease in AFB interactions (p= 0.000). There was a decrease in the contribution of AFB in the control group before with after intervention (p= 0.000). There are those who support (p= 0.033) giving vitamin D the acceleration of pulmonary tuberculosis treatment. Conclusion: It is better to administer vitamin D to the successful treatment of pulmonary TB in patients undergoing anti-tuberculosis drug therapy.

The objective of this research was to analyze whether flexibility training can improve agility, speed, and power performance, during physical education classes or not. This is a quantitative, descriptive and field research, with 5th grade students duly enrolled at Prof.ª Hilda Romazini Melo School, União da Vitória- PR, in the year 2018. In order to perform the study, the students were divided into two different samples, sample A for the experimental group, which did flexibility training for 8 weeks, and sample B, control group, both of them did the pre and post test of the physical capacities. In order to collect data, pre and post-tests were performed for each physical capacities analyzed: square agility test, to measure agility, Wells Bank to measure flexibility, 20-meter test to measure speed and Long Jump test to check power. Furthermore, it was observed that the training improved besides the flexibility, the power of the students in 100%. Nevertheless, it was possible to realize that the training helped the students to keep the speed and it is not possible to say whether the training benefits the agility of students or not. Thus, the research leaves the suggestion of giving sequence to its elaboration, since this subject, has extreme relevance and should gain prominence in Physical Education and related areas.
